India and Israel have strengthened their strategic partnership, marked by recent defense cooperation agreements and high-level diplomatic visits. Both nations emphasize mutual challenges from terrorism and support regional connectivity initiatives like the India-Middle East-Europe Economic Corridor. India maintains its support for the Palestinian cause while pursuing independent relations with Israel. The Shah Bano case, a pivotal moment in Indian legal history, continues to influence debates on women's rights and the Uniform Civil Code. In Sudan, a protracted civil war has led to severe humanitarian consequences, with international actors calling for urgent ceasefire and peace efforts.
